A little taste of your day-to-day:
- Maintain the entire hotel apartment facility including the physical building structure, all mechanical, electrical, FLS, HVAC systems, and other related equipment in accordance with energy conservation and preventative maintenance programs.
- Ensure the upkeep of guest areas to maintain IHG standards.
- Conduct house tours and visually assess the safe and efficient maintenance and operation of the physical structures of the hotel apartment, all mechanical electrical HVAC systems, and any other related equipment.
- Verify completion of all routine maintenance on public spaces and verify completion of all repairs, replacements, and renovation projects to offices and employee work areas.
- Follow prescribed safety procedures for personnel and equipment by IHG standards / HACCP / Dubai Municipality standards and Civil Defense standards.
- Maintain effective energy management and preventive maintenance programs and conduct special training for other operating departments on the safe and efficient use of equipment and energy in the hotel apartments.

What we need from you:
- Degree/Diploma in Mechanical/Electrical/HVAC Engineering
- Minimum of four years of experience in a managerial role within the hospitality industry.
- Sound knowledge of AutoCAD.
- Excellent communication and organizational skills.
- Strong attention to detail.
- Strong ability to identify and rectify subsystem faults.
- Proficient in Microsoft Office suite.
